Simply put, case management software solutions are tools designed to help businesses manage and track their cases or projects more effectively These solutions provide a centralized platform where all relevant information, documents, and communication related to a case can be stored and accessed by authorized personnel This ensures that everyone involved in a project is on the same page and working towards a common goal.
Case management software solutions come with a wide range of features that can help businesses automate and streamline their processes Some of the key features typically found in these solutions include task management, time tracking, document management, communication tools, reporting and analytics, and integration with other software systems By providing a centralized platform with these features, case management software solutions can help organizations increase efficiency, reduce errors, and improve collaboration among team members.
One of the most important benefits of using a case management software solution is the ability to track and monitor the progress of a case or project in real-time With features like task management and time tracking, businesses can easily keep track of all the activities and milestones associated with a case, allowing them to identify any bottlenecks or issues that may be hindering progress This real-time visibility into the status of a case enables organizations to make informed decisions and take corrective actions to ensure that projects are completed on time and within budget.

By providing a centralized platform where all communication related to a case can be stored and accessed, these solutions help ensure that all team members are on the same page and have access to the information they need to complete their tasks effectively This can help reduce misunderstandings, prevent duplication of efforts, and foster a more collaborative work environment.
Furthermore, case management software solutions can help businesses improve their overall productivity by automating repetitive tasks and streamlining workflow processes For example, these solutions can automate the assignment of tasks, send reminders and notifications to team members, and generate reports and analytics to track performance metrics By automating these routine tasks, businesses can free up valuable time and resources that can be better utilized on more strategic activities that drive growth and profitability.
In addition, case management software solutions are highly customizable and can be tailored to meet the specific needs and requirements of different organizations Whether you are a small business looking to streamline your customer support processes or a large enterprise managing complex legal cases, there is a case management software solution out there that can help you achieve your goals These solutions can be customized to incorporate your existing workflows, business rules, and data fields, ensuring a seamless integration with your existing systems and processes.
